The Last Story Undub is a fan-modified version of the 2011 Nintendo Wii JRPG that restores the original Japanese voice acting while retaining English localized text. This "undub" project allows players to experience the game with the vocal performances intended by its creators, Hironobu Sakaguchi and Nobuo Uematsu. Key Features of the Undub Version

Original Audio: Replaces the Western voice-overs (which were primarily British in the European/NA release) with the original Japanese voice track.

Localized Text: Keeps the English menus, subtitles, and UI elements from the official Xseed Games or Nintendo localizations.

Cross-Regional Support: Patches are available for both North American (NTSC-U) and European (PAL) ISOs. Note that save files are typically regional; a PAL save may not work with an NTSC-U undubbed ISO. Gameplay & Technical Highlights

Getting The Last Story set up with the "Undub" patch (Japanese audio with English text) involves modifying a North American (USA) or European (PAL) ISO file. If you are specifically looking for "Fates," that likely refers to the undub projects hosted on platforms like the UndubProject on Reddit or similar ROM hacking communities. 1. Prerequisites

Original Game File: You need a clean ISO or WBFS file of The Last Story (typically the North American version is preferred for many undub patches). The Last Story Undub is a fan-modified version

Undub Patch Files: Download the specific patch files (often containing a PatchIt!.bat or similar script).

Tools: You will likely need Wii Backup Manager to convert files between ISO and WBFS formats. 2. Patching the ISO

Extract the Patch: Use a tool like 7-Zip or WinRAR to extract the downloaded undub patch into its own folder.

Prepare the Game File: Place your clean The Last Story ISO or WBFS file into the same folder as the patching tool.

Run the Patcher: Execute the batch file (e.g., PatchIt!.bat). The script will automatically replace the English audio files with the Japanese ones and rebuild the image.

Verify the Output: Once finished, you should have a new "Undub" ISO or WBFS file ready for use. 3. Playing the Game Title: The Last Story: Undub Fates Method A:

On a Wii Console: Use a USB loader like USB Loader GX or WiiFlow. Ensure your Wii has the necessary d2x cIOS installed to recognize the games from your USB drive.

On PC (Dolphin Emulator): Simply point Dolphin to the folder containing your newly patched ISO. You can also apply HD Texture Packs and a 60FPS patch for a better visual experience. 4. Important Compatibility Notes Ultimate USB Loader GX Guide 2021+ (Play ISO Backups)

The Legacy of The Last Story

Today, The Last Story remains a cult classic. It is one of the few Wii games that truly looks like a next-gen title, utilizing tricks with lighting and blur to hide the low polygon counts.

As the Wii eShop closes and physical copies become expensive collector's items, the ISO becomes the primary way new players will discover Zael and Calista’s story. And for those players, the "Fates" version—the Undub—offers a bridge between worlds. It allows a non-Japanese speaker to experience the game with the same audio atmosphere that Sakaguchi and his team originally crafted.

Whether one prefers the English dub or the Japanese original is a matter of taste. But thanks to the modding community, players at least have the power to choose their own fate.
